Git作为现代软件开发中不可或缺的版本控制工具,已经成为研发团队协作的核心。掌握Git不仅能够提升个人工作效率,还能显著改善团队协作的流畅度。
在日常开发中,分支管理是确保代码稳定性的关键。主分支(如main或master)应保持干净,所有新功能或修复应通过特性分支进行开发,并在合并前进行代码审查。
合并冲突是团队协作中常见的问题。遇到冲突时,应优先与相关开发者沟通,明确各自修改的内容,再通过手动解决冲突,确保代码逻辑的一致性。
提交信息的规范性同样重要。清晰、简洁的提交信息有助于后续的代码追踪和问题定位。建议遵循“类型+范围+简要描述”的格式,例如“feat: 添加用户登录功能”。
定期拉取最新代码可以避免大量冲突的积累。在开始新任务前,先将主分支的更新拉取到本地,确保开发环境的同步。
使用Git的图形化工具(如VS Code、Sourcetree等)可以提高操作效率,但理解命令行操作仍是深入掌握Git的基础。
AI绘图结果,仅供参考
•持续学习和实践是精通Git的关键。通过参与开源项目或团队内部的代码重构,能更深入地理解Git的实际应用场景。